#678971 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#678971 is composed of 40.4% red, 53.7%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.5%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 137.6 degrees, a saturation of 14.2% and a lightness of 47.1%. #678971 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ffe2 with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#678971 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#678971 has RGB values of R:103, G:137,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 6785393.

Shades and Tints of #678971
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020302 is the darkest color, while #f6f9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#678971
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#708075 is the less saturated color, while #01ef47 is the most saturated one.
